The latest version of PuTTY SSH and Telnet client adds protection against spoofing the terminal authentication prompt to steal login info. The update comes after a 20-month hiatus and fixes a total of eight security issues. The problem is with the user interface and fixing it proved to be a challenge because the UNIX terminal model offers the server remarkable control over what is shown. The fix was to print an interactive message before the start of the main session.
